The upmost Manhattan plot represents the case-control analysis, where controls were dogs with an FCI score A/A and cases were dogs with an FCI score B/C, C/B, or C or worse on both hips (N = 693). The second Manhattan plot represents the case-control analysis, where cases were dogs with an FCI score D or worse on both hips (N = 520), and the lowest Manhattan plot is the comparison between mild cases (B/C, C/B, C/C) to moderate-to-severe cases (D or worse on both hips) (N = 340).
